1.检查数据库文件路径和文件名: 确保指定的路径和文件名拼写正确,而且文件确实存在于指定的位置。使用绝对路径或相对路径都是可行的,但要确保路径的正确性
string connectionString = @"Provider=Microsoft.ACE.OLEDB.12.0;Data Source=E:\第12Csharp数据库\bin\Debug\0713db2.accdb";
2.确认数据库文件格式和连接字符串的匹配: 确保使用的数据库连接字符串与数据库文件的格式匹配。例如,对于Access数据库(.accdb文件),使用OLEDB提供程序可能是一种常见的选择。
string connectionString = @"Provider=Microsoft.ACE.OLEDB.12.0;Data Source=E:\第12Csharp数据库\bin\Debug\0713db2.accdb";
如果是其他数据库,可能需要使用不同的连接字符串和提供程序
3.检查程序权限: 确保程序运行时有足够的权限来访问指定路径下的文件。在某些情况下,需要以管理员身份运行程序或者授予程序访问指定路径的权限。
如果使用的是Visual Studio调试程序,还要确保数据库文件没有被锁定,因为Visual Studio可能会在调试期间锁定文件。
4.尝试使用相对路径: 如果可能,尝试使用相对于应用程序目录的路径,而不是绝对路径。这样可以避免在不同环境中可能导致路径不匹配的问题。
string connectionString = @"Provider=Microsoft.ACE.OLEDB.12.0;Data Source=.\bin\Debug\0713db2.accdb";
上位机电气自动化plc编程全套入门教程+工具https://s.pdb2.com/pages/20230307/CnORDNt9HimMjNS.html